解决方案简介:跨社区持续集成(XCI)通过增加网络功能虚拟化开放平台(OPNFV)与上游社区之间的协作来实现创新

By 三月 26, 2018LFN Resource

2017年对通信服务供应商(CSP)的一项调查指出,80%的被调查者认为DevOps软件开发模式(DevOps)对于网络功能虚拟化(NFV)的成功来说至关重要、不可或缺。DevOps最主要的活动就是评估DevOps工具链和基础架构的自动化及测试。从OPNFV的角度来看,DevOps意味着通过应用持续集成(CI)和持续交付(CD)的原理、自动化和实践,来开发、测试、部署和监控软件系统,从而为开发团队、发行团队和运营团队的协同工作实现文化和思维方式的改变。

OPNFV项目通过构建复杂的持续集成(CI)管道来支持DevOps开发模式。在XCI之前,OPNFV只是集成了OpenStack,OpenDaylight,FD.io等上游项目的最新主要版本。这些项目的主要版本发行可能会有几个月的间隔,比如六个月。等待这么长时间再去集成是次优的,因为它延迟了OPNFV社区成员能够接触到最新上游创新的速度;同时也延迟了上游社区能够从OPNFV测试中获得有价值反馈的速度。

OPNFV XCI计划通过对这几个上游项目的最新软件版本进行定期集成和测试,解决了这个问题。在本解决方案简介中,您可以了解到XCI如何面对复杂的测试挑战,如何缩短实现新功能和修复漏洞的时间,从几个月缩短到几天。

DOWNLOAD NOW